The report large temperature was 109°File in September 2001. The incredibly hot weather conditions will dehydrate the soil and when a summertime thunderstorm comes the soil is swiftly rehydrated. The dehydration of the soil has shrunk the soil plus the rapid hydration has expanded the soil. This method, repeated various occasions a 12 months, can inflict tremendous hurt on a house’s foundation. And when There's an extended duration of drought, the soil beneath households and buildings will shrink significantly. When this occurs the clay soil will pretty much pull away from the part of The underside of the concrete slab, creating a void. When this void gets much too large, this are in the slab foundation basically cracks and “falls” till it reaches one thing to guidance it – the shrunken soil. This known as settlement.
